With due diligence, the purchaser can verify the assumptions underlying the purchase price and economic forecasts. For example, an evaluation of the target's financial declarations might disclose variances in earnings acknowledgment, underfunded obligations, or unsustainable margins. These findings can bring about adjustments in the acquisition rate or the inclusion of earn-out provisions to line up rewards.
